A subtle change in Android 16 Beta 4 adds Dynamic Color to the always-on display (AOD) clocks. 

Previously, the thin outlines for all clocks were white. The following expressive, bubbly clocks now make use of Dynamic Color on the Pixel AOD.

This applies to both the fullscreen and shrunken (top-left corner) versions. 

Depending on your theme, this change might not be obvious given how thin the AOD clocks are. Just compare it to the corner date and battery percentage. This touch of color matches the weather icon.

Green appears to be the most standout hue in our brief testing. In general, this makes the clocks slightly darker than the previous white versions, but the change is noticeable.

What are Dynamic Color AOD Clocks?

Dynamic Color AOD Clock, as the name suggests, dynamically changes the color of the clock displayed on your Always-On Display. It leverages your device’s existing theme or wallpaper colors to create a harmonious and visually appealing AOD experience. Rather of a static white or gray clock, the AOD clock adapts to your phone’s overall aesthetic, offering a more cohesive and customized look. This adaptability typically extends to not just the clock digits but also to other information displayed on the AOD, such as notification icons or widget data.

How Does Dynamic Color work?

The implementation of dynamic Color varies across different manufacturers and operating systems. However, the core principle remains the same: analyzing the dominant colors in the user’s selected theme or wallpaper and applying them to the clock elements on the AOD. Here’s a general overview of the process:

  • Color Extraction: The system algorithms extract the most prominent colors from the phone’s wallpaper. This can involve techniques like averaging pixel colors, identifying color clusters, or using more refined image processing algorithms.
  • Color Palette Generation: Based on the extracted colors, a limited palette is generated. This palette typically consists of a primary color (for the main clock elements), a secondary color (for accents or shadows), and possibly a tertiary color (for highlights or notification icons).
  • Clock Coloring: The generated color palette is then applied to the AOD clock elements. The system dynamically updates the clock’s color whenever the wallpaper or theme changes. Typically, the system attempts to ensure contrast and readability even when adjusting the color.
  • Fine-Tuning & User Customization: Some implementations provide user controls.This can involve modifying the intensity of the colors, selecting from pre-defined color palettes based on the wallpaper, or even manually picking specific colors for the clock elements.

Which Devices Offer Dynamic Color AOD Clocks?

The availability of Dynamic Color AOD Clocks depends on the device manufacturer and the operating system version. While it’s becoming increasingly common,it’s not a standard feature on all devices. Here are several manufacturers who have implemented variations of this feature:

  • Samsung: Samsung’s One UI features dynamic theming which directly impacts the AOD clock colors. the “color Palette” feature extracts colors from your wallpaper and applies them system-wide, including to the AOD.
  • Google (Pixel): Google’s Material You design language, found on Pixel devices, places a strong emphasis on dynamic color theming. This theming extends to the AOD clock, providing a seamless integration between the wallpaper and the displayed time.
  • OnePlus: Certain OnePlus devices, especially those running OxygenOS based on android 12 and later, incorporate dynamic theming capabilities that affect AOD clock colors.
  • Other Android OEMs: Many other Android OEMs have begun incorporating dynamic theming into their own custom Android skins, which can then influence the AOD clock’s color.

To check if your device has Dynamic Color AOD Clock functionality, navigate to your phone’s settings, then look for options related to theming, customization, or Always-On Display.The specific settings may vary depending on your device’s manufacturer and Android version.
